SPECIAL MEETING

",' 8

NORTH TARRYTOWN, N.Y
APRIL 30th, 1984

A Special Meeting of the Board of Trustees of the Village
of North Tarryown was held on the above date for the purpose of
adopting the Budget for the fiscal year June 1st, 1984 to May 31st,
1985.
Present:

Absent:

James J. Timming, Deputy Mayor
'Vincent Buonanno,
William McBride
Robert King,
Susan Galgano,
Steven Salman,
Trustees

\*H

Philip E. Zegarelli, Mayor

Deputy Mayor Timmings called the meeting to order at 9 P.M
He asked if there was anyone present who would like to
address the Board.
Fire Chief Lawrence Kosilla stated that he understood that
the Fire Budget had been cut some $10,000. from the Tentative Budget
and asked why.
Deputy Mayor Timmings stated that many accounts had been
cut in order to keep the tax rate down.
After a discussion Deputy Mayor Timmings stated that
various resolutions had to be adopted.
Trustee King moved, seconded by Trustee Galgano that the
Budget of the Department of Water and Sewer be adopted in the amount
$459,429. said adoption being pursuant to the provisions of Chapter
809 of the Laws of 1954 and the Budget Manual for Villages and the
Uniform Sytem of Accounts as set forth in the Manuals issued by the
Division of Municipal Affairs, Albany, N.Y. Carried.

Trustee King, moved seconded by Trustee Galgano, that the
1984 budget concerning the General Fund be adopted pursuant to the
provisions of Chapter 809 of the Laws of 1954 and the Budget Manual
for Villages and the Uniform System of Accounts as set forth in the
Manuals issued by the Division of Municipal Affairs, Albany, N.Y.
Carried.

Trustee King moved, seconded by Trustee Galgano, that the
tax rate be levied pursuant to law and that the rate be $74.41 per
M for the year 1984. Carried.

Trustee King moved, seconded by Trustee Galgano, that the
tax payment be in two equal installments, the first installment
payable on June 1, 1984 and continuing up to and including June 30,
1984 and the second installment commencing December 1st, 1984 and
continuing up to and including December 31, 1984. Carried.

Trustee King moved, seconded by Trustee Galgano that
the Mayor be authorized to sign the Tax Warrant for the collection
of the 1984 taxes, and that the same be presented to the Treasurer
and Tax Collector with the Assessment Roll. Carried.
Trustee King moved, seconded by Trustee Galgano that the
following resolution be adopted:
WHEREAS certain Village employees are retained on an annual
basis, now, therefore,
BE IT RESOLVED that the following employees of the Village 1
of North Tarrytown are retained on an annual basis, and shall receive.
no more than their annual pay during any fiscal year. This provision!
shall apply to all such annual salaried employees regardless of the
number of pay periods or pay days contained in the fiscal year, and
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that all such salaried employees be
notified of this statement and determination of policy by the Board
of Trustees of the Village of North Tarrytown.

There being ito further business to come before the Board,
Trustee Salman moved, seconded by Trustee Galgano that the same be
duly adjourned.
